Got to Get Out, the Hulu reality TV show, introduced viewers to contestants who compete to secure the million-dollar prize fund. Each player has to complete challenges and tasks to fill the pot money. Locked in a mansion away from the outside world, each contestant gets a clue and a chance to run away with the prize fund by plotting an escape.
In a conversation with TV Insider on April 17, 2025, the Got to Get Out cast member and The Golden Bachelor alum opened up about her experience being part of the reality competition series. Despite not having watched much reality TV, Susan was looking forward to showcasing her skills in this game of alliances and deception.
Susan shared that she was authentically herself on the show. She continued:
“It’s still me. The best part of reality TV for me is I get to be me. I’m not acting. I’m not trying to sell something that I’m not. I am who I am.”
The show format is described as:
"Participants living in a mansion for 10 days vie for a cash prize that increases by $1 each second they’re in the game. As contestants compete in physical and mental challenges, more money will be added to “the pot,” with up to $1 million at stake."
Got to Get Out star Susan Noles shares her first impression of his fellow castmates
In her interview, Got to Get Out star Susan Noles talked about her first interaction with Omarosa Manigault. Susan shared that she was not much aware of the reality TV world and wasn't familiar with the well-renowned faces from shows such as The Real Housewives. When Susan told Omarosa that she doesn't watch reality TV, Omarosa's reaction made Susan question if she was "going to be intimidated." Susan narrated the interaction by stating:
“When I said, ‘I don’t watch reality TV,’ Omarosa came walking over and stood in my face and said, ‘You do not say, ‘I don’t watch reality TV,’ here.’ I had three seconds to decide if I was going to be intimidated. And I took two more steps and went right [up to her], and said, ‘I just did!'”
At first, Susan formed a friendship with Demi Burnett when the contestants entered the mansion. She shared that despite the tensions between her and Omarosa, they both became friends during their time in the mansion. The Got to Get Out star said:
“When I walked in the door of the mansion, we were to mingle, and Demi [Burnett] was next to me, and I heard someone speak, and I went, ‘Who the hell is that? She’s rude,' [Demi said], ‘Susan, you don’t know who that is? She’s known for her villainous [ways].'”
Additionally, Susan got the opportunity to escape but failed to do so after multiple attempts. Meanwhile, Cynthia Bailey received a clue in Episode 5, which she used to her advantage by partnering up with Stein Retzlaff; they both took $156,030 each. The sixteen players, after Clare Crawley and Jill Ashlock's departure, split $687,940 evenly.
